Toggle navigation
Log In
Leaderboards
Search
About
Healthy Futures
FAQ
Log In
Candace Necochea
2019 Challenge
CycleDude
-
Fun Teams
View Other Challenges
3.0
total miles
Activity
Amount
Unit
Miles
Date Completed
Running
3
miles
3.0
Wednesday, May 01 2019